如Python所示,sys.stdout.write()Ruby中的等价物是什么?
这是我正在使用的代码:
public class splitText {
public static void main(String[] args) {
String x = "I lost my Phone. I shouldn't drive home alone";
String[] result = x.split(".");
for (String i : result) {
System.out.println(i);
}
}
}
Run Code Online (Sandbox Code Playgroud)
编译完美,但在运行时没有任何反应.我究竟做错了什么?
我将xaml中tabitem的背景颜色设置为RED,但是当我运行它并将鼠标悬停在它上面或选择它时,它会更改默认的灰色外观.仅在选择其他tabitem时才能正确显示.我如何一直保持红色.谢谢!
我有一个批处理文件,我需要在我的NSIS安装程序中运行.它必须在提取完所有文件后运行(我想这很明显,否则批处理文件还不存在).
我尝试将MUI_PAGE_CUSTOMFUNCTION_PRE与完成页面一起使用以运行它,但是当它到达脚本的那一部分时,它似乎跳过它.以下是我如何调用它.
;;Finish Page
!define MUI_PAGE_CUSTOMFUNCTION_PRE Done
!insertmacro MUI_PAGE_FINISH
Function Done
ExecWait '"$INSTDIR\BatchFile" "$INSTDIR" "$DATA_FOLDER"'
FunctionEnd
Run Code Online (Sandbox Code Playgroud)
在此先感谢您的帮助.
UPDATE
我现在尝试使用以下内容:
ExpandEnvStrings $0 %COMSPEC%
ExecWait '"$0" /C "$INSTDIR\batch.bat" "$INSTDIR" "$DATA_FOLDER"'
Run Code Online (Sandbox Code Playgroud)
这不起作用,所以我拿出/ C看看cmd提示符说的是什么(它弹出,但立即关闭),好像它执行了cmd.exe,但就是这样,它没有完成其余的执行.
更新#2
可以在这里找到导致我使用它的核心知识:
无论出于何种原因.bat文件都不同意ExecWait.
到底:
ExecWait '"$INSTDIR\BatchFile.cmd" "$INSTDIR" "$DATA_FOLDER"'
Run Code Online (Sandbox Code Playgroud)
工作得很好.
我想过滤计数的查询结果.
select count(distinct tmr_id) AS Count ,CONTRACTID from status_handling
Run Code Online (Sandbox Code Playgroud)
此查询返回2列,如:
计算ContractID
1 23344
2 28344
2 34343
2 29344
1 26344
Run Code Online (Sandbox Code Playgroud)
我只是过滤2(计数)值.我怎样才能做到这一点?
谢谢.
我刚刚开始使用Google Guice作为依赖注入框架,并试图将其改造为我最近写的一个中小型项目.我理解Guice如何工作的基础知识,但对于一些方法细节我有点模糊.例如:
1)模块用于定义绑定,然后将其输入喷射器.您是否倾向于将所有内容放入一个模块中,或者您是否倾向于将内容分解为许多较小的模块?
2)您是否在顶层有一个注射器注入整个对象树或多个点状注射器,只注入您真正需要注入的依赖关系?我在想我自己的代码库,当然,它有许多依赖项,但在测试期间我只需要控制一小部分.
3)我稍微坚持使用仅测试环境模块而不是生产版本来获得系统/集成测试的最佳方法.这个问题可能是特定于实现的,但我很好奇人们使用什么方法.作为参考,我的应用程序是基于servlet的Web应用程序.
还有其他指针吗?
我在控制台应用程序中重现了我的问题.以下是代码.
using System;
using System.Collections.Generic;
using System.Linq;
using System.Text;
namespace LinqSample
{
class Program
{
static void Main(string[] args)
{
string query = "Maine, Maryland, Massachusetts, M";
var queries = query.Trim().Split((new[] { "," }), StringSplitOptions.RemoveEmptyEntries);
string lastQuery = queries[queries.Length - 1].Trim();
if (queries.Length > 1)
{
var remQueries = queries.Take(queries.Length - 1).ToArray();
string[] suggestions = new string[] {"Maine", "Maryland", "Massachusetts", "Michigan", "Minnesota",
"Mississippi", "Missouri", "Montana"};
System.Console.WriteLine("Before Except ");
suggestions.ToList().ForEach(str => { System.Console.WriteLine(str); });
var unqiueSugs = from sug in suggestions …Run Code Online (Sandbox Code Playgroud) 我应该如何将包含函数的multicolum索引输入schema.rb?
例如,这不起作用:
add_index "temporary_events", ["templateinfoid", "campaign", "date(gw_out_time)", "messagetype"], :name => "temporary_events_campaign_tinfoid_date_messagetype"
Run Code Online (Sandbox Code Playgroud)
rake db:test:load
耙子流产了!
PGError:错误:列"date(gw_out_time)"不存在
:CREATE INDEX"temporary_events_campaign_tinfoid_date_messagetype"ON"temporary_events"("templateinfoid","campaign","date(gw_out_time","messagetype")
我想将此 x86 ASM代码移植到C或C++,因为我不了解ASM =)
搜索谷歌接缝Relogix和IDA Pro可以做到这一点.但我认为它们不便宜,因为我只有这一个来源.
理解数学或算法如何工作将同样好,因为我将使用OpenGL.
还有其他方法吗?
;
; a n d r o m e d a
;
; a 256b demo
; by insomniac/neon
;
code SEGMENT
ASSUME CS:code, DS:code
p386
LOCALS
ORG 100h
max = 4096
maxZ = 5000
b EQU byte ptr
Start: lea di,vars
mov ch,60
rep stosw
mov al,13h
int 10h
p al: mov al,cl
mov dx,3c8h
out dx,al
inc dx
cmp al,64
jb b64_1
mov al,63
b64_1: out dx,al …Run Code Online (Sandbox Code Playgroud) 我(VB.NET新手)正在对一个函数进行一些代码维护,这个函数有时会抛出异常"错误转换字符串"False"(或"True")到Integer类型." 我发现的东西与此相当
someVal是一个字符串,someFun1返回一个Integer,someFun2将一个Integer作为参数
...
someVal = someVal = someFun1()
...
someFun2(someVal)
...
Run Code Online (Sandbox Code Playgroud)
我认为可能发生的是它试图将someFun1的返回值分配给someVal,然后执行bool检查someVal是否已经改变 - 但我不认为这是需要做的事情.
我的问题是 - 这个双重赋值(someVal = someVal = someFun1())完成了我在VB.NET中不知道的任何事情吗?
另一个注意事项:我意识到有整数到字符串的隐式强制转换并返回整数,但这不应该导致任何问题,因为值应该始终保持一个数值(可以从Integer和String中隐式地来回转换) ,对吧?)不是对错 - 据我所知
java ×2
asp.net-mvc ×1
assembly ×1
batch-file ×1
c ×1
c# ×1
c++ ×1
filtering ×1
guice ×1
indexing ×1
linq ×1
nsis ×1
oracle ×1
postgresql ×1
python ×1
ruby ×1
select ×1
split ×1
sql ×1
stdout ×1
styles ×1
tabcontrol ×1
tabitem ×1
vb.net-2010 ×1
wpf ×1
wpf-controls ×1